About Category Labs

Category Labs specializes in decentralized systems within the blockchain technology sector. The company offers a layer 1 blockchain named Monad, which is compatible with the Ethereum Virtual Machine and supports 10,000 transactions per second with one-second block times and single-slot finality. Category Labs' solutions are primarily targeted at sectors that require blockchain infrastructure with a focus on performance and decentralization. Category Labs was formerly known as Monad Labs. It was founded in 2022 and is based in New York, New York.

Check Your 1 Million Nads NFT Airdrop on Monad

Mar 30, 2025

The NFT’s Role in Potential Airdrops There’s speculation that holding the “1 Million Nads” NFT might be a key factor in qualifying for Monad’s future airdrops. This could be part of a strategy to filter out bots and reward genuine community engagement. Similar Past Campaigns: Aptos previously launched a similar campaign where users who minted and held a commemorative NFT were later airdropped around 500 APT , worth over $1,500 at the time. Monad Testnet Is Still Ongoing Users can still interact with Monad’s ecosystem by exploring and testing projects live on the testnet. However, keep in mind: While there are rumors that testnet participation won’t guarantee an airdrop, some community members believe an airdrop is still highly likely. Why a testnet airdrop makes sense: As a new Layer 1 blockchain, Monad is focused on building a fair and transparent image. Testnet users are early supporters — a valuable group for community building. Distributing tokens to testnet participants also helps increase the initial number of holders, which is a key metric for any L1 project. Other Potential Airdrop Criteria In addition to testnet participation and holding the “1 Million Nads” NFT, several other actions and assets may influence a user’s eligibility for future Monad airdrops. These include: Community Role (Nads Role on Discord) Active participation on Monad’s social channels can earn users the Nads role in the official Discord. This path is ideal for those skilled in content creation or community engagement. By contributing through posts, discussions, and sharing updates, users may be granted this role — which is believed to be a strong signal for airdrop eligibility. Although the Monad community is growing rapidly, the number of OG roles distributed so far remains under 1,000. This presents a valuable opportunity for new contributors to take initiative. Notably, the OG role is currently being traded OTC for $2,000–$3,000, further signaling its perceived value. Difficulty: High Stake-to-Airdrop Given Monad’s association with the Jump ecosystem, staking relevant tokens like W  or PYTH  may increase a user’s chances of receiving an airdrop. Previously, Wormhole rewarded the top 10,000 $PYTH stakers with an airdrop — setting a potential precedent. Current benchmarks for the top 10,000 stakers: $PYTH: ~$1,600 Difficulty: Moderate to High (Capital-dependent) Estimated Airdrop Likelihood: 50–60% Hold-to-Airdrop MadLads Highly likely to be included. Monad has invested in Backpack — which serves as its primary wallet — and MadLads is closely tied to the Backpack ecosystem. Difficulty: High (High cost entry) Estimated Airdrop Likelihood: 90% Pythenians Closely aligned with the Pyth Network, which itself has strong ties to Monad. Although the community isn’t currently deeply involved in Monad-related activities, its positioning within the Jump ecosystem still makes it a potential candidate. Difficulty: Medium Pudgy Penguins & Wassies Both projects have founders who are angel investors in Monad. This indirect connection may increase the likelihood of inclusion. Difficulty: Medium to High Conclusion The “1 Million Nads” NFT is not just a commemorative drop — it may be part of a broader, curated airdrop strategy by Monad. Monad encourages users to stay engaged with the ecosystem and monitor the evolving eligibility criteria. Provenance Blockchain Logo
Provenance Blockchain

Provenance Blockchain provides production blockchain protocol. The company provides an online platform that acts like a global ledger, registry, and exchange across assets and markets and it facilitates loans to be originated, financed, sold, and securitized. The company was founded in 2018 and is based in San Francisco, California.

Solana Logo
Solana

Solana provides a blockchain platform that enables the processing of transactions, catering to both power users and new consumers. It facilitates game tooling, payment tooling, financial infrastructure, and more. Its services are primarily utilized in the cryptocurrency and decentralized applications industries. The company was founded in 2018 and is based in San Francisco, California.

Lisk Logo
Lisk

Lisk is a Layer 2 blockchain project that aims to enhance Web3 adoption in emerging markets through scalable technology and interoperability with Ethereum. The company provides a blockchain network that allows developers to build and scale applications with low fees, while also offering support to founders in high-growth markets. Lisk is a member of the Optimism Superchain. It was founded in 2016 and is based in Zug, Switzerland.

Arcology Logo
Arcology

Arcology is a blockchain platform focused on scaling Ethereum through parallel transaction execution. The company provides services that enable decentralized applications (DApps) by processing transactions simultaneously, including complex smart contracts, via multiple Ethereum Virtual Machine (EVM) instances. Arcology's architecture offers tools and libraries for Solidity developers to utilize the platform's execution capabilities. It is based in United States.

Polkadot Logo
Polkadot

Polkadot is a digital platform focused on enabling Web3 interoperability and decentralized blockchain innovation. Polkadot's main services include blockchain connectivity and security, energy-efficient consensus through nominated proof-of-stake, and a governance system for network upgrades and protocol management. It was founded in 2016 and is based in Zug, Switzerland.

Ethereum Logo
Ethereum

Ethereum is a decentralized platform that allows the creation and execution of smart contracts and decentralized applications (dApps) on its blockchain. The platform supports cryptocurrency transactions, digital asset management, and the development of various blockchain-based applications, including those for finance, gaming, and social interaction. Ethereum's infrastructure enables the tokenization of assets and the operation of decentralized finance (DeFi) services, while also addressing user privacy and data security. It was founded in 2014 and is based in Zug, Switzerland.
